Jonah Werner and Friends Come to the Boulder Theater For Safehouse Benefit Concert 12/15

By: Nov. 20, 2009

JONAH WERNER & FRIENDS Safehouse Benefit Concert Tuesday, December 15 doors: 7:00pm, show:7:30pm

Jonah Werner is a singer songwriter you don't want to miss. He's a musical and lyrical phenom. His music style is unique and cutting edge. He writes lyrics like a modern day Kerouac, and he plays the guitar like you've never seen. With open tuning mastery, Jonah incorporates tapping, looping, finger and flat-picking in his songs. His concert style is a cross between David Wilcox and Jason Mraz, with original storytelling, wordplay and crowd interaction. Jonah has released 5 albums in the last 7 years and tours internationally.
